Tamil Nadu has successfully attracted investments worth over Rs 9 lakh crore in the past three years, generating 31 lakh new jobs, as announced by Chief Minister M K Stalin on Wednesday.

Prior to his planned visit to the United States next week to attract more investors, Stalin revealed a series of new projects valued at Rs 68,773 crore, which are expected to generate an additional 1 lakh jobs in the state.

Among the newly unveiled endeavors are 19 projects worth Rs 17,616 crore, and the foundation stones for 28 projects valued at Rs 51,157 crore. This strategic move aims to showcase Tamil Nadu's economic potential and growth trajectory to a global audience.
